You can use *top* command to know traffic of processes in your cpu.

another if you want to debug that running application then you can also try
gdb

# gdb --pid <pid_of_application>

> > I got a user-mode application without symbol and source, and it keeps
> > console no response about 2 mins.
> > I just want to know whether it is busy on processing itself or do the
> > context switch frequently for calling kernel drivers at that time.
>
> well then, strace/ltrace is probably the right tool to do the job :)
> or just use /proc/<pid>/stack :)
